GUJ
Notícias, artigos e o maior fórum brasileiro sobre Java
home
fórum
notícias
tópicos recentes
empregos
artigos
Bem-vindo ao GUJ.
Crie seu login
, ou digite-o para logar no site.
Usuário:
Senha:
Dúvida combo aninhada com Struts + DWR
Índice dos Fóruns
»
Ferramentas, Frameworks e Utilitários
Autor
Mensagem
14/12/2009 16:48:22
Assunto:
Dúvida combo aninhada com Struts + DWR
Pedrosa
JWizard
Membro desde: 13/07/2005 13:08:08
Mensagens: 2505
Localização: São Paulo - Brasil
Offline
Olá srs, estou tentando montar uma combo aninhada com DWR + Struts:
Tenho a classe mapeada no dwr.xml, que monta tudo certo
public class ComboDocumentoFormalizacao { public List<VModalidadeProduto> getModalidades(String produto){ List<VModalidadeProduto> modalidades = new ArrayList(); try { modalidades = CommonAFAPHelper.getInstance().listarModalidades(Integer.parseInt(produto)); } catch (Exception e) { e.printStackTrace(); } return modalidades; } }
E a seguinte chamada JSP:
function getModalidades(){ var produto = document.forms[0].produtoSelecionado.value ComboDocumentoFormalizacao.getModalidades(produto, { callback: function(lista) { DWRUtil.removeAllOptions("modalidadeSelecionada"); DWRUtil.addOptions("modalidadeSelecionada", lista, "cdModalidadeProduto", "nmModalidadeProduto"); }, errorHandler: function(errorString, exception) { setMsgError(errorString, 'block'); }, timeout: 50000 } ); }
Meu <htm: select> do struts esta assim:
<html:select property="modalidadeSelecionada" > <html:option value="0">SELECIONE</html:option> <html:optionsCollection property="modalidades" label="nmModalidadeProduto" value="cdModalidadeProduto"/> </html:select>
Ao chamar a função na minha combo anterior ele simplesmente limpa essa combo, e não popula corretamente, alguém sabe onde preciso ajustar?
14/12/2009 17:06:37
Assunto:
Re:Dúvida combo aninhada com Struts + DWR RESOLVIDO
Pedrosa
JWizard
Membro desde: 13/07/2005 13:08:08
Mensagens: 2505
Localização: São Paulo - Brasil
Offline
Resolvido, troquei o metodo para retornar um Map e no meu JSP troco a chamada e uso dessa forma:
DWRUtil.addOptions("modalidadeSelecionada", mapa);
This message was edited 2 times. Last update was at 14/12/2009 17:07:29
Índice dos Fóruns
»
Ferramentas, Frameworks e Utilitários
Ir para:
Selecione um Fórum
Notícias
Assuntos gerais (Off-topic)
MundoJ - Artigos, Notícias e Debates
Artigos e Tutoriais
Java Básico
Java Avançado
Ferramentas, Frameworks e Utilitários
Desenvolvimento Web
Interface Gráfica
Google Android e Java Micro Edition (ME)
Certificação Java
Persistência: Hibernate, JPA, JDBC e outros
Java Enterprise Edition (Java EE)
Frameworks e Bibliotecas brasileiros
RIA - Flex, JavaFX e outros
Arquitetura de Sistemas
Metodologias de Desenvolvimento e Testes de Software
JavaScript
Ruby & Ruby on Rails
Outras Linguagens
Powered by
JForum 2.1.8
©
JForum Team